The role
of DKK1 in cancer

DKK1 is produced and secreted by cancer cells, functions on several tumor pathways and nearby immune cells.

Enhances
MDSC cells
Inhibits B-catenin dependent Wnt signaling to enhance suppressive activity.
Prevents
NK cell activation
Helps tumor cells avoid NK cell mediated killing.

Angiogenesis
Upregulates VEGFR2, increases formation of tumor blood vessels.
Cell proliferation
Signals through CKAP4 to activate PI3K / AKT signaling
